Output 63ef9fba3a365eea6b41b3d53e85eac7a18da9245495f1f59c2448bd928319d3:0

value
64490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a25ec8adf676e2dfd02dee6ed41de35f55b17ed OP_EQUAL
address
3HCgEAFFUqRVWkptvkcUN7y8Qj8xNNu2KE
transaction
63ef9fba3a365eea6b41b3d53e85eac7a18da9245495f1f59c2448bd928319d3
spent
true